首页 > 其他分享 >盘点一个Pandas新手在文件读取路上遇到的问题

盘点一个Pandas新手在文件读取路上遇到的问题

时间:2022-11-05 23:24:41浏览次数:45  
标签:读取 代码 如下 问题 瑜亮 新手 Pandas

大家好,我是皮皮。

一、前言

国庆期间在Python铂金交流群【暮雨和】问了一个Pandas处理的问题,提问截图如下:

代码截图如下:

新手上路,遇到的问题还是挺多的。

二、实现过程

这里【瑜亮老师】和【沧海一声笑】指出问题如下:

后来他还问到怎么让读的时候不加第一列的索引呢?如下所示:

不过这还没有完,问题又来了。如下图所示:

为什么第一个红框的能读写出来,后面几个都是一样的写法,为什么要报错呢?

这里其实很细节,一开始还误以为是编码的问题,后来【瑜亮老师】指出,方法用错了。

原始文件是csv文件,应该是用pd.read_csv()去读取,而不是pd.read_excel()。修改正确之后,就顺利地的解决了问题。

后来还问了一个问题,如下图所示:

这个问题很常见,【不上班能干啥!】指出,在写入的时候,加一个参数index=False即可。

后来还发现少了一个库,安装完成之后,代码顺利跑起来了。

三、总结

大家好,我是皮皮。这篇文章主要盘点了一个Pandas处理的问题,文中针对该问题,给出了具体的解析和代码实现,帮助粉丝顺利解决了问题。

最后感谢粉丝【暮雨和】提问,感谢【瑜亮老师】、【沧海一声笑】、【不上班能干啥!】、【此类生物】给出的思路和代码解析,感谢【dcpeng】、【冫马讠成】等人参与学习交流。

标签:读取,代码,如下,问题,瑜亮,新手,Pandas
From: https://www.cnblogs.com/dcpeng/p/16861649.html

相关文章

  • Numpy与Pandas简介
    一、Numpy与Pandas是什么?Numpy(NumericalPython)是Python语言的一个第三方库,支持大量的维度数组与矩阵运算,此外也针对数组运算提供大量的数学函数库。Numpy是一个运行......
  • 读取数组树下的某值,并返回其父级下的任何值 vue
    1//遍历树获取对应id的项中的值2queryTree(tree,value){3letstark=[];4stark=stark.concat(tree);5while(stark.length)......
  • 20、读取成绩文件排序数据
    题目:  输入文件:三列:学号、姓名、成绩列之间用逗号分割,比如”101,小张,88“行之间用\n换行分割待处理文件名:  内容如下:    思路:  1、先把读取文件函数......
  • 博客园主题美化——适合新手的详细攻略
    大家好,应该有很多新手对博客园主题该怎么进行优化而感到困惑吧。我在更改主题的过程中,也有着很多困惑,在看了很多博客后才更改成功,因为那些博客的内容都很零散,所以我记录下......
  • Python 文件读取
    需要打开文件,使用内置函数open()函数open()函数返回文件对象,此对象有一个read()方法用于读取文件内容 读取文件“1.txt”z=open("1.txt",'r')print(z.read())只......
  • Python_pandas_数据分析
    一、pandas简介pandas是基于NumPy构建的一个强大的Python数据分析的工具包。主要功能:具备对其功能的数据结构:DataFrame、Series集成时间序列功能提供丰富的数学运算......
  • 盘点一个Pandas写入csv文件的小问题
    大家好,我是皮皮。一、前言前几天在Python铂金交流群【红色基因代代传】问了一个、Pandas处理的问题,提问截图如下:原始数据如下图所示:下面是他自己写的代码:withopen("r......
  • IO(四、)FileReader第一种读取方式
    importjava.io.FileNotFoundException;importjava.io.FileReader;importjava.io.IOException;publicclassFileReader1{publicstaticvoidmain(String[]args......
  • Python文件操作 - 读取写入
    文件操作文件读取关键字with:不再需要访问文件后将其关闭函数open():接受要打开的文件名称.参数若为文件名:Python在当前执行的文件所在的目录中查找指定的文件参数为相......
  • js 读取文件
    //上传文件调用fileChange(fileData){letraw=file.rawletfileParamListletreader=newFileReader()reader.readAsText(fileD......